Ingredients You’ll Need

Before you start cooking, gather all your 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need for this tasty one-pan dish:

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up long-grain white rice
  • 4 cups chicken broth (low-sodium preferred)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 4 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ish
  • Optional: lemon wedges for serving

Step-by-Step Cooking Instructions

Now that you have all your ingredients ready, let’s get cooking! Follow these simple steps to make your One Pan Garlic Chicken with Rice.

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

Start by patting the chicken breasts dry with paper towels. This helps achieve a nice sear. Season both sides of the chicken generously with salt, pepper, and paprika. The paprika will not only add flavor but also a beautiful color to your chicken.

Step 2: Sear the Chicken

In a large skillet or a deep pan,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Once the oil is hot, add the chicken breasts. Sear the chicken for about 5-7 minutes on each side until they’re golden brown. It’s important not to overcrowd the pan; if needed, cook the chicken in batches. Once done, rem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.

Step 3: Sauté the Garlic

In the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ium and add the minced garlic. Sauté for about 30 seconds, stirring constantly to prevent it from burning. The aroma will be heavenly, and this step is crucial for infusing flavor into the rice.

Step 4: Cook the Rice

Add the rice to the skillet, stirring to coat it with the garlic and oil. Toasting the rice for a minute or two will enhance its flavor. Then, pour in the chicken broth and add the dried oregano. Stir well to combine all the ingredients.

Step 5: Combine Chicken and Rice

Return the seared chicken breasts to the skillet, nestling them in the rice mixture. The chicken should be partially submerged in the broth.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, cover the pan with a lid, and reduce the heat to low. Let it cook for about 20 minutes or until the rice is tender and the chicken is cooked through.

Step 6: Fluff and Serve

Once the cooking time is up, turn off the heat and let the pan sit covered for an additional 5 minutes.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ully. After the resting period, remove the lid and fluff the rice with a fork. The rice should be perfectly cooked, and the chicken juicy and tender.

Tips for Perfect One Pan Garlic Chicken Rice

While this recipe is straightforward, here are some tips to ensure your dish turns out perfectly every time:

  •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h garlic and high-quality chicken will elevate the flavor of your dish. If you can, opt for organic chicken and fresh herbs.
  • Watch the Liquid: If you find your rice is too dry, add a little more chicken broth during cooking. If it’s too wet, remove the lid and let it simmer for a few additional minutes.
  • Experiment with Flavors: Feel free to add other spices or herbs to customize the flavor. Thyme, rosemary, or even a pinch of red pepper flakes can add a nice twist.
  • Vegetable Add-ins: Consider adding vegetables like peas, bell peppers, or spinach during the last few minutes of cooking for added nutrition and color.

Storage and Reheating

If you have leftovers (which is unlikely because it’s so delicious!), store the One Pan Garlic Chicken Rice in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, simply microwave it in short intervals or warm it up in a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of chicken broth to keep it moist.

Tips for Perfecting Your One Pan Garlic Chicken Rice

To ensure that your One Pan Garlic Chicken Rice turns out perfectly every time, consider these additional tips:

  • Marinate the Chicken: For added flavor, marinate the chicken in garlic, olive oil, lemon juice, and herbs for at least 30 minutes before cooking. This step infuses the meat with extra taste and tenderness.
  • Use a Heavy-Bottomed Pan: A good quality, heavy-bottomed skillet or Dutch oven will distribute heat evenly, preventing any hotspots that can scorch the rice.
  • Adjust Cooking Time: Depending on the thickness of your chicken breasts, you may need to adjust the cooking time slightly. Ensure that the internal temperature reaches 165°F for safe consumption.
  • Rest Before Serving: Allow the chicken to rest for 5 minutes after cooking. This helps to retain the juices and keeps the meat moist.

Storing Leftovers

Leftovers from your One Pan Garlic Chicken Rice can be just as delicious the next day! Here are some tips for storing and reheating:

  • Cool Before Storing: Allow the dish to cool to room temperature before transferring it to an airtight container. This prevents condensation which can make the rice soggy.
  • Refrigerate Promptly: Store in the refrigerator within two hours of cooking to keep it safe to eat. It can last for up to 3-4 days when stored properly.
  • Freezing for Later: If you want to enjoy it later, this dish freezes well! Portion it into freezer-safe containers, and it can be stored for up to 3 months.

Reheating Tips

When you’re ready to enjoy your leftovers, proper reheating is key to maintaining flavor and texture:

  • Microwave: Place a portion in a microwave-safe dish, cover it with a damp paper towel, and heat in short intervals, stirring occasionally until warmed through.
  • Stovetop: Reheat in a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of chicken broth or water to moisten the rice as it heats.
  •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C), place the dish in an oven-safe container, cover with foil, and heat for 15-20 minutes.
